What is The Glory about?

Song Hye-kyo plays Moon Dong-eun, a woman who survived years of systematic torture by her high school classmates and has spent her entire adult life engineering a way to destroy them. That is the premise, and it is not subtle about it. The show opens with flashbacks to the abuse, which are genuinely hard to watch, and then pivots to the long, slow machinery of Dong-eun's plan, which involves inserting herself into the lives of her tormentors by becoming the homeroom teacher of one bully's daughter. It is a melodrama that takes its own cruelty seriously.

What makes The Glory distinctive is its tone: cold, patient, almost meditative. Kim Eun-sook, the writer behind lighter romantic fare, pushes into much darker territory here, and the show carries that shift with conviction. Song Hye-kyo is largely expressionless by design, Dong-eun having hollowed herself out in service of her mission, and it works. The real fireworks come from the supporting cast. Lim Ji-yeon as the chief villain is operatically awful in the best possible way, and Yeom Hye-ran as a quiet ally stuck in her own abusive marriage gives the show most of its emotional texture.

The series became a massive global hit for Netflix in early 2023, breaking into its most-watched charts across multiple regions and drawing significant critical attention, particularly around Lim Ji-yeon's performance. Audiences responded to the slow-burn structure, though some found the second half, released in March 2023, slightly less taut than the first. The pacing is deliberate to the point of testing patience, and the romantic subplot between Dong-eun and Lee Do-hyun's character is the weakest thread, feeling imported from a different, softer show.

Among Korean revenge dramas it belongs with the more calculating entries. The satisfaction it offers is architectural: watching pieces click into place, not watching feelings explode. The tagline, "let's wilt and die together," is a fair promise of what the show delivers.

Why did The Glory end?

The Glory wrapped after one sixteen-episode season, which is exactly what Netflix and the show's creator Song Yeon-hee had planned from the start. This wasn't a case of the plug being pulled early or a network losing faith in the material. The story of Moon Dong-eun's methodical revenge against her high school tormentors was conceived as a complete narrative arc, and the structure reflected that vision: sixteen episodes aired over two and a half months, telling a contained story from setup to conclusion.

The show arrived fully formed and executed its vision without compromise. It had strong viewership and critical reception (8.2 on IMDb is solid for a Netflix drama), which gave the creators the freedom to end on their own terms rather than scramble to extend or justify a quick cancellation. Korean dramas, particularly on Netflix, often follow this pattern of arriving as self-contained stories rather than open-ended series banking on renewal. Song Yeon-hee had more to say in The Glory than a typical limited series format demands, and Netflix was willing to greenlight the full sixteen-episode order upfront to tell it properly.

This was a finale that aired as intended, not a cancellation that felt premature. The show did what it set out to do and stopped.
